Output 8e8276db46c02a187635dfcb9a880dbc07e927de590ae10dffbf3d6ea79d4a7d:0

value
649683
script pubkey
OP_0 OP_PUSHBYTES_20 03555da26cf25fd79e90f0e528f366ef0702aedf
address
bc1qqd24mgnv7f0a085s7rjj3umxaurs9tkldwequz
transaction
8e8276db46c02a187635dfcb9a880dbc07e927de590ae10dffbf3d6ea79d4a7d
confirmations
18300
spent
true